
LMQ Level 7 Postgraduate Diploma in Health and Social Care Management is designed to provide focused and specialist courses, linked to professional body requirements and National Occupational Standards where appropriate, with a clear work-related emphasis.
There is a strong emphasis on practical skills development alongside the development of requisite knowledge and understanding in the sector. They are particularly suitable for more mature learners who wish to follow a programme of study that is directly related to their work experience or to an aspect of employment that they wish to move into in due course.

This is a stand-alone qualification, but there are entry requirements. Applicants must have obtained one of the following:
LMQ Level 06 Health and Social Care or any Level 06 recognized Qualification accepted by LMQ education board.
Overseas qualifications, has judged by UK NARIC, to be equivalent in standard to a level 6 qualification in the UK (or higher) or 3 years Senior management work experience in the reputed organization.

LMQ Level 7 Postgraduate Diploma in Health and Social Care Management qualification consists of six mandatory units for a combined total of 120 credits, 1200 hours Notional Learning Hours (NLH) for the completed qualification.
Notional Learning Hours (NLH) is defined as Notional learning hours include all the learning activities that are required to achieve the learning outcomes.
Credit value is defined as being the number of credits that may be awarded to a Learner for the successful achievement of the learning outcomes of a unit. One credit is equal to 10 hours of NLH.
L/PGDHSCM/7001 | Strategic Leadership Practice | 20 |
L/PGDHSCM/7002 | Managing Service Delivery in Health and Social Care | 20 |
L/PGDHSCM/7003 | Managing Enterprise in Health and Social Care | 10 |
L/PGDHSCM/7004 | Strategic Marketing for Health and Social Care | 10 |
L/PGDHSCM/7005 | Research Methods for Strategic Managers | 20 |
L/PGDHSCM/7006 | Project Development and Implementation | 20 |
L/PGDHSCM/7007 | Strategic Change and Organisational Behaviour | 20 |
